What you can expect

Join a walking tour and uncover the forgotten Black history of Lisbon. Learn how the city was deeply shaped by the transatlantic slave trade and how its legacy continues to influence Portuguese society today.

Begin your tour at the iconic riverside squares where enslaved people arrived as cargo. Hear documented stories of enslaved women working in city markets, Black religious brotherhoods offering dignity and mutual aid, and burial sites quietly absorbed into the modern city.

Visit the first Black neighborhoods outside of Africa where Black Lisboetas lived, worked, prayed, and built community. Gain a deeper understanding of how Lisbon functioned within the Black Atlantic world and how its legacy greatly shapes Portuguese society today.

By the end of the tour, leave with a powerful human perspective and a deeper appreciation of the city of Lisbon.
